Oracle 11g 新特性 -- 自动诊断资料档案库(ADR) 说明(一)

2014-11-24 18:21:32 · 作者: · 浏览: 2

1.1 ADR 说明


从Oracle Database11g R1 开始,将忽略传统的…_DUMP_DEST 初始化参数。ADR 根目录又称为ADR 基目录,其位置由DIAGNOSTIC_DEST 初始化参数设定。如果省略此参数或将其保留为空,数据库将在启动时按如下方式设置DIAGNOSTIC_DEST:


如果已设置了环境变量ORACLE_BASE,则将DIAGNOSTIC_DEST 设置为$ORACLE_BASE。


如果未设置环境变量ORACLE_BASE,则将DIAGNOSTIC_DEST 设置为$ORACLE_HOME/log。



--验证:


[18:02 oracle@dave ~]$echo $ORACLE_BASE


/u01/app/oracle


[18:03 oracle@dave ~]$ora param diag


Session altered.



NAME ISDEFAULTSESMO SYSMOD VALUE


------------------------- --------- -------------- ----------------------------------------


diagnostic_dest FALSE FALSE IMMEDIATE /u01/app/oracle



我这里设置了ORACLE_BASE 的环境变量,所以这里的diagnostic_dest 参数使用了ORACLE_BASE的值。



ADR 基目录中可以包含多个ADR 主目录,其中每个ADR 主目录都是一个根目录,用于存放特定Oracle 产品或组件的特定实例的全部诊断数据。前一张幻灯片的图形中显示了数据库的ADR主目录位置。


另外,还生成了两个预警文件。一个是文本形式的预警文件(与早期版本Oracle DB 使用的预警文件非常相似),位于各个ADR 主目录的TRACE 目录下。还有一个符合XML 标准的预警消息文件,存储在ADR 主目录内的ALERT 子目录下。可使用EnterpriseManager 和ADRCI 实用程序查看文本格式的预警日志(已删除了XML 标记)。


INCIDENT 目录包含多个子目录,每个子目录均以特定意外事件命名,并且仅包含与该意外事件相关的转储。


HM 目录包含由健康状况监视器生成的检查器运行报告。


还有一个METADATA 目录,其中包含资料档案库自身的重要文件。可以将此目录比作数据库字典。可使用ADRCI 查询此字典。


ADR 命令解释器(ADRCI) 是一个实用程序,可用于执行支持工作台允许的所有任务(但是仅限于在命令行环境中)。使用ADRCI 实用程序,您还可以查看ADR 中跟踪文件的名称以及删除了XML 标记、具有和不具有内容筛选功能的预警日志。


此外,还可以使用V$DIAG_INFO列出一些重要的ADR 位置。





使用tree命令查看目录结构:


[18:11 oracle@dave /u01/app/oracle/diag]$tree


.


|-- asm


|-- clients


|-- crs


|-- diagtool


|-- lsnrctl


|-- netcman


|-- ofm


|-- rdbms


| `-- dave


| |-- dave


| | |-- alert


| | | `-- log.xml


| | |-- cdump


| | | |-- core_16650


| | | |-- core_18804


| | | `-- core_6039


| | |-- hm


| | |-- incident


| | | |-- incdir_13378


| | | | |-- dave_cjq0_16650_i13378.trc


| | | | `-- dave_cjq0_16650_i13378.trm


| | | |-- incdir_13458


| | | | |-- dave_ora_18804_i13458.trc


| | | | `-- dave_ora_18804_i13458.trm


| | | `-- incdir_8529


| | | |-- dave_mmnl_6039_i8529.trc


| | | `-- dave_mmnl_6039_i8529.trm


| | |-- incpkg


| | |-- ir


| | |-- lck


| | | |-- AM_53417_1688101061.lck


| | | |-- AM_53417_2985279723.lck


| | | |-- AM_53419_3606358678.lck


| | | |-- AM_53421_2401899358.lck


| | | |-- AM_58174112_2445060518.lck


| | | `-- AM_994187642_3287667720.lck


| | |-- metadata


| | | |-- ADR_CONTROL.ams


| | | |-- ADR_INTERNAL.mif


| | | |-- ADR_INVALIDATION.ams


| | | |-- AMS_XACTION.ams


| | | |-- DDE_USER_ACTION.ams


| | | |-- DDE_USER_ACTION_DEF.ams


| | | |-- DDE_USER_ACTION_PARAMETER.ams


| | | |-- DDE_USER_ACTION_PARAMETER_DEF.ams


| | | |-- DDE_USER_INCIDENT_ACTION_MAP.ams


| | | |-- DDE_USER_INCIDENT_TYPE.ams


| | | |-- DFW_CONFIG_CAPTURE.ams


| | | |-- DFW_CONFIG_ITEM.ams


| | | |-- EM_DIAG_JOB.ams


| | | |-- EM_TARGET_INFO.ams


| | | |-- EM_USER_ACTIVITY.ams


| | | |-- HM_FDG_SET.ams


| | | |-- HM_FINDING.ams


| | | |-- HM_INFO.ams


| | | |-- HM_MESSAGE.ams


| | | |-- HM_RECOMMENDATION.ams


| | | |-- HM_RUN.ams


| | | |-- INCCKEY.ams


| | | |-- INCIDENT.ams


| | | |-- INCIDENT_FILE.ams


| | | |-- INC_METER_CONFIG.ams


| | | |-- INC_METER_IMPT_DEF.ams


| | | |-- INC_METER_INFO.ams


| | | |-- INC_METER_PK_IMPTS.ams


| | | |-- INC_METER_SUMMARY.ams


| | | |-- IPS_CONFIGURATION.ams


| | | |-- IPS_FILE_COPY_LOG.ams


| | | |-- IPS_FILE_METADATA.ams


| | | |-- IPS_PACKAGE.ams


| | | |-- IPS_PACKAGE_FILE.ams


| | | |-- IPS_PACKAGE_HISTORY.ams


| | | |-- IPS_PACKAGE_INCIDENT.ams


| | | |-- IPS_PACKAGE_UNPACK_HISTORY.ams


| | | |-- IPS_PROGRESS_LOG.ams


| | | |-- IPS_REMOTE_PACKAGE.ams


| | | |-- PICKLEERR.ams


| | | |-- PROBLEM.ams


| | | |-- SWEEPERR.ams


| | | |-- VIEW.ams


| | | `-- VIEWCOL.ams


| | |-- metadata_dgif


| | |-- metadata_pv


| | |-- stage


| | | |-- stg3_13378_inc2.stg


| | | |-